Transaction 721a3c39e563a3c1eaeb5715ef9b79bdc31e042ab9aadf45852425fedd241a14
2 Input
2 Outputs
- 721a3c39e563a3c1eaeb5715ef9b79bdc31e042ab9aadf45852425fedd241a14:0
- 721a3c39e563a3c1eaeb5715ef9b79bdc31e042ab9aadf45852425fedd241a14:1
value 371851
address 1CFMcFVqYeo4MLZgf8okEVxZsT9rfxwkB4
value 3561804
address 3DenMS1wr9RJnuQ5ZUuaUrFKVnc9XRNfFB